That, indeed, is the IF frequency.  The lousy design of today's AM 
receivers lets the 453 kHz signal go right into the IF strip to 
interfere with whatever station you tune to.  At least with an external 
antenna.  That is the case with my high end Luxman stereo receiver and a 
Sansui Quadraphonic receiver.

It seems all the hi-fi/stereo/quad stuff has this lousy AM front end 
design.  The lab is in Loudoun county and I have to add an outdoor 
antenna on the roof to get enough signal clear of all the inside 
interference.  Along with the clean AM signal comes this 453 kHz signal. 
  I added a tuned filter on the front end and it fixes the problem.

>> Good News for 2005
>> Dear friends,
>>         last week I got a permission to operate a MW-transmitter from 
>> the German RegTP (Regulierungsbehörde für Telekommunikation und Post). 
>> It will be used for studies of progagation and testing modern 
>> receiving modes.
>> Some data:
>> Frequency 440KHz, bandwidth 200Hz, max. 9W ERP
>> Call DI2AG (the DI-prefixes are for test and research only, therefore 
>> this is no hamradio application).
>> Modes A1A, A1B, F1B, G1B. Location JN59NO.
>> The permission is valid in 2005.
>> The TX will be operated as a beacon, QRSS3 prefered, with a text like 
>> "DI2AG JN59NO 1W". This will be repeated in normal CW.
